    Abstract

    From Maxwell's electromagnetic theory, dipole approximation method is used to deduce the coupling constant between the optical field and dielectric nanometric spherical particles. It is found that the best resolution still exists in the near-field optical microscope for these dielectric particles and happens at the position where the far field counteracts the near field.
